Bee-keeping in Cal. -- Schliesmayer's home apiary
Visual Materials
Wide view of several rows of bee hive boxes in an open area at the apiary of Conrad Schliesmayer in Pasadena, California. A woman, two children, and two men stand among the boxes. One man stands next to a camera on a tripod. A windmill, water tanks, outbuildings, tree, and horses also dot the landscape.

34th Annual Convention - Natl. Bee-Keepers Assn. - Los Angeles, Cal
Visual Materials
Group portrait of men and women sitting and standing on the steps of the Los Angeles County Courthouse during the 34th annual convention of the National Bee-Keepers Association on August 19, 1903.
